logind: rework how we manage the slice and user-runtime-dir@.service unit for each user
Instead of managing it explicitly, let's simplify things and rely on
regular Wants=/Requires= dependencies to pull in these units from
user@.service and the session scope, and StopWhenUneeded= to stop these
auxiliary units again. This way, they can be pulled in easily by
unrelated units too.
This simplifies things quite a bit: for each session we now only need to
manage the session scope, and for each user the user@.service, the other
units are not something we need to manage anymore.
This patch also makes sure that if user@.service of a user is masked we
will continue to work, and user-runtime-dir@.service will still be
correctly pulled in, as it is now a dependency of the scope unit.
